Currently, there are 100 active underground stone mines operating in 19 states as shown in Figure 1. Eighty-six of these mines extract crushed, broken limestone, while the remaining extract various crushed or dimensional stones. Underground stone mines can have a long mine life. The mining sector played a minor role in Haiti's economy. Mining was limited to clays and limestone for cement manufacture (a leading industry in 2002), marble, marine salt, and sand and gravel. Asphalt and lime also may have been produced. The marble industry was being developed for export possibilities.

The Meme copper mine, in the Terre-Neuve Mountains of Haiti, is one of the largest hypogene metal mines in the Greater Antilles. Mineralization at the Meme deposit is localized at the contact between the 66 m.y.-old Terre-Neuve quartz monzonite and a large block of Upper Cretaceous limestone that was surrounded by the intrusion.

Chemical analyses of the Eocene limestone bedrock from low-silica aluminous lateritic soil localities in Haiti and in the Dominican Republic show less than 0.1 percent of alumina. If this limestone is the immediate source of the lateritic soil, a large volume of limestone was weathered to yield the known deposits.

The mining and minerals industry in Haiti

Haiti has a mining industry which extracted minerals worth approximately US$20 million in 2019. Bauxite, copper, calcium carbonate, gold, and marble were the most extensively extracted minerals in Haiti. Lime and aggregates and to a lesser extent marble are extracted.

Riviere Gauche Northeast Of Trouin Manganese Occurrence

The primary ore mineral extracted from this area is pyrolusite, a manganese oxide. Geologically, the surrounding region is characterized by limestone formations dating back to the Upper Cretaceous epoch, approximately 100.50 to 66.00 million years ago. These limestone rocks serve as the host for the mineralization in this area.

Haiti

Haiti contained relatively small amounts of gold, silver, antimony, tin, lignite, sulphur, coal, nickel, gypsum, limestone, manganese, marble, iron, tungsten, salt, clay, and various building stones. Mining activity in the late 1980s focused on raw materials for the construction industry.

Meme Copper Mine Near Gonaives, Haiti | The Diggings™

The Meme Copper Mine, located near Gonaives in Haiti, was initially discovered in 1956 by Consolidated Halliwell Ltd. Operations at the mine were carried out from 1957 to 1988.
